# Heads up, team: this is the scheduling core for Sproutline, our
# plant-watering service. It decides when each planter on the Fernagle
# rooftop deck gets its next drink. We bias toward early-morning runs
# because afternoon watering evaporates before the roots notice, and we
# skip cycles entirely when the moisture probes read above threshold.
# If the basil in the demo bed looks sad again, tweak here first before
# blaming the pumps. The knobs we agreed on at last week's sync are
# captured below.

limits module of tawep-hawif:
WEIGHTS = {
    "sordor": 228,
    "kasax": 458,
    "ulaox": 8,
    "casix": 495,
    "briix": 335,
}

## Step 2: Idempotency keys for retries

If your plugin retries a payment call against Tollbooth, you must reuse the same idempotency key, or customers get double-charged and we all have a bad week. Keys live for 48 hours by default. Your plugin should pull the retry window from these values.

deployment values, faduf-tawep:
SORDOR_LOG_LEVEL=error
SORDOR_METRICS_HOST=metrics.sordor.nelvrolabs.internal
SORDOR_POOL_SIZE=4

Rollout framework (Togglewright) — notes from Tuesday sync. Phase 1: percentage-based flags only, no cohort targeting yet. Contractors get read access to the flag console; changes go through PR review. Kill-switch path tested in staging, prod test pending. Docs live in the Togglewright wiki. Questions on flag lifecycle or stuck rollouts go to the framework owner:

signatory, tahof-bafog: Holix Holdor

Subject: [release] TileHound prefetcher 2.4 ready for sign-off

Hi Marisol — TileHound 2.4 passed full QA, including the new coastal-zoom prefetch heuristics and the memory-cap fix for low-end devices. All regression suites are green and staging soak ran 48 hours clean. For your sign-off records, the candidate build identifier is included below.

pipeline stamp: htk4_ae36

## Migrating Cron Jobs to Driftwheel

We're moving the old crontab entries into Driftwheel, our workflow engine, so retries and alerting stop being duct tape. Each legacy job becomes a workflow definition with an explicit schedule block — reviewers, please check the timezone fields carefully. Submissions go through the internal registration endpoint, which authenticates with the key below.

gateway credential: kto7_GoY89Me